Why Choose an Orangery?Before delving into the best installers, let's briefly go over why an orangery is a fantastic addition to any home:
- Increased Natural Light: The substantial use of glass in orangeries allows for more natural light inside your home.
- Flexible Use: Whether a home or work space, an orangery can adapt to your lifestyle.
- Boosted Aesthetic Appeal: They can considerably enhance the appearance and value of your home.
- Connection to the Outdoors: An orangery creates a smooth transition between your home and garden.

1. What is the distinction between an orangery and a conservatory?
An orangery generally has a more considerable brick base and larger windows, typically incorporating more solid building than a conservatory, which is mainly glass.
2. How long does an orangery installation take?
The setup time can differ, but typically it takes in between 6 to 12 weeks from initial style to conclusion.
3. Do I require preparing approval for an orangery?
Oftentimes, you might not need preparation permission if the orangery meets particular size and design criteria, but it's important to talk to your regional council.
4. How can I maintain my orangery?
Regular cleaning of glass panels and ensuring the drain system is clear will help keep your orangery. Check seals and frames every year.
5. Can I utilize my orangery year-round?
Modern orangeries can be created with appropriate insulation and heating, making them appropriate for year-round usage.
